Whiting-Turner is currently seeking a talented Cost Engineer/Estimator to join our well-established national construction company in their headquarters located in Baltimore, Maryland. The Cost Engineer/Estimator will represent Whiting-Turner while supporting the Cost & Estimating Group in the calculation of material quantity requirements, gathering and preparing routine estimating data and compiling data for use in all types of estimates.

  • Assist in the preparation of preliminary budgets, conceptual estimates and detail estimates for projects of varying size and complexity.
  • Assist in the preparation of detailed cost estimates by analyzing plans and specifications and performing quantity takeoffs for Civil, Structural, and Architectural trades, throughout all stages of preconstruction and construction.
  • Interact with internal preconstruction/construction project managers, architects, engineers, and subcontractors.
  • Work closely with project management and project development teams. Hand off estimate to project management team with the intent that the project team will make all final adjustments.
  • Work with project team, and design team to find value engineering options.
  • Develop a working knowledge of material unit costs, systems square foot costs and total building square foot costs.
  • Keep current on changes and trends in methods of construction and materials.
  • Participate in design progress meetings and client presentations as required.
